    Today, we're proud to introduce a brand new weekly column here at Massively called Choose my Adventure, lovingly stolen from our siblings at WoWInsider (now WoW.com). The concept is simple: we create a brand new character in an MMO and document its adventure in a special image gallery and a weekly journal post -- but with a catch. Everything from the goals to the character creation and even the game itself will be chosen by YOU! That's right, you will have the opportunity to chose what game, race, class, gender, questlines and more for my character as I progress my way though to an ultimate goal.How will this work? Starting with today's introductory post, you can vote in the poll below for which game I will begin my adventure. Of course the options are limited to what I have available to me right now, but as each goal is met for each new character (voted on later), I will start fresh and restart the process with a new game. This will give me the opportunity to explore more games and show you what may or may not work best. Sound like fun? Keep reading below for more.

    We're all still slaving away on WoW.com, finding bugs and filing feedback. To help that process along, we're going to try a little experiment. I'm going to level a character from level 1 to level 80, and all of it will be documented on my WoW.com profile. The hook is that you guys are going to decide most aspects of this character, such as race, class, and talent spec.Such things will be determined largely via polls right here on the front page of WoW.com, where I'll be giving weekly updates on my progress along with what I've learned about the class and the world and any other observations I might have. If you want a little more detail on the process such as where I'm going, what I've done, and any other little notes I make via the Adventurer's Note feature, you can follow that on my profile. If you don't dig our profiles portion of the site, hey, no problem. You'll still get weekly updates right here on the blog until I'm level 80.There are two polls: Race and Class. I will play whichever choices are the most popular. If the chosen race can't actually be the chosen class, I'm going to go with whatever is the most popular class that I can actually play as that race.
